High-ranking official has been caught red-handed while taking bribe, according to the press center of the Agency for State Financial Control and Combating Corruption.  

The anticorruption agency says Saydamir Fayziddin, the Head of the State Inspectorate for Explosives Control at the State Service for Supervision over the Safe Conduct of Work in Industry and Mining under the Government of Tajikistan, has been detained on suspicion fraud.

He demanded 23,000 somonis from citizen “A” for the issuance of a license for conducting mine surveying and using production facilities being at risk of fire, according to the anticorruption agency press center.

Fayziddin has reportedly been caught red-handed while taking the bride.  

Criminal proceedings have been instituted against Saydamir Fayziddin under the provisions of Article 247 of Tajikistan’s Penal Code – fraud; an investigation is under way.
